Complete Comparative Guide: Discover Bhagavata Mela vs Krishnattam and Their Unified Spirit

Bhagavata Mela (Tamil Nadu) and Krishnattam (Kerala) are classical dance-dramas devoted to Lord Krishna that developed in distinct regional ecologies yet share a unifying bhakti ethos. This comparison clarifies their origins—Melattur’s community-centered ritual theatre versus Guruvayur’s temple-offering cycle—and explains how aesthetics, music, language, and costume differentiate their experiences.
